Damage to the Door

There are a variety of issues that can arise with a double glazing windows glazed door over time. Certain issues are minor and don't impact the overall performance of the window. Others can cause serious issues. Whether the damage is caused by weather, wear and tear or mishandling, it is essential to seek out a professional immediately.

Clouding or fogging is a common issue between the glass panes in double-glazed units. This problem is caused when moisture gets into the dead space between the glass panes. It could also be caused by fluctuations in temperature which cause the gas sealed inside to expand and contract.

The best method to address this problem is to contact an expert who can eliminate the moisture between the glass panes unit. This will restore a clear view and prevent energy loss. Repairs for double-glazed doors can be costly based on the extent and type of damage and the level of the work to be done. Glass replacement for the front door is typically the most expensive due to the amount of wear and tear that is put on this area of the home. It could be anything from toys and balls that are thrown, to lawnmowers who kick up rocks. The cost of replacing glass in the back door is less costly, as the door is not used as often and does not receive as much abuse as the front door.

Another common repair is to replace misted or cloudy double glazing. This is caused by moisture in the panes which causes condensation. A specialist company in UPVC repairs can resolve this at a reasonable cost. Some companies even offer to drill holes in the window to draw out the moisture however this isn't a permanent solution and only works for about six months.
